Teaching aids (TAs): Teaching aids are objects (such as a book, picture, or map) or devices (such as a DVD or computer) used by a teacher to enhance or enliven classroom instruction (Merriam-Webster). Digital assessments provide students fast feedback on their understanding, letting both students and instructors concentrate their efforts on where further understanding is most required. Digital learning contexts allow teachers to build in different types of assessments to periodically assess student understanding. Free tools like Google Docs have made it easy for students to work on the same piece of writing at home and at school, and have allowed teachers to explore collaborative writing assignments and synchronous editing with students.
